Mansfield Train Station is equipped with numerous facilities aimed at making your journey as smooth as possible. Ticket purchasing is simplified with a ticket office open Monday through Saturday from 7:00 AM to 2:00 PM, and ticket machines are available for convenience. Holders of online tickets can collect them from the ticket office, and accessible ticket machines are on-site for ease of use. The station also supports travelers with auditory impairments through an induction loop system.
Accessibility at Mansfield Station is commendable, with step-free access catering via ramps and subways, making it navigable for all passengers. Waiting rooms offer comfortable seating and operating hours from 6:00 AM to 5:00 PM during weekdays, slightly adjusted for Saturdays. While refreshment facilities and shops aren't available within the station grounds, Mansfield's town center is just a stone's throw away, teeming with options to satiate your needs.
Mansfield offers various transport connections beyond the rail. Whether by bus, taxi, or personal vehicle, your onward journey is supported by several options. Rail replacement services operate from the Sports Direct lay-by at the rear of the station, ensuring continuity even when train services are interrupted. Local taxis can be swiftly contacted at 01623 652005 or 01623 624121, while car parking facilities are ample, boasting 103 spaces available around the clock.

Hatton Train Station may not be the most equipped in terms of facilities, but what it offers is simplicity and the charm of a rural railway station. For ticketing, there's no traditional ticket office, but you can easily collect tickets from the available ticket machines. Unfortunately, the station does not boast accessible ticket machines, so be prepared to have your ticket needs sorted in advance if accessibility is a concern.
There is no staff help available on-site, making it essential for passengers to be self-reliant or to plan ahead if assistance is needed. In case of any urgent queries or needs, a customer help point is available. CCTV is operational, providing a bit of extra peace of mind for safety-conscious travelers.
Accessibility is somewhat limited, with step-free access available only to Platform 1, primarily for those headed towards London. If you're traveling with mobility considerations, it's crucial to plan for accessibility, as there are no ramps for train access, and the waiting room facilities are non-existent.
For those looking to relax or grab a bite before or after their journey, it's important to note that Hatton Station does not currently offer any ref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s. However, it's a great place to cycle to if you live nearby—with 12 bicycle storage spaces on Platform 1. While the storage isn't sheltered, the presence of CCTV adds an element of security.
Parking is quite competitive, with 48 spaces available free of charge, including one accessible space. Although it might lack high-end facilities, it allows travelers the flexibility to park their vehicles while they board their train.
When it comes to moving onward from Hatton, this station connects you with more than just railways. The station provides details on its bus services through printable guides, which can help you plan your local transport connections efficiently.
In situations where rail services are disrupted, mini-buses serve to bridge transport gaps. Unfortunately, these may not cater to passengers with mobility impediments, so it’s always a good idea to arrange alternatives or ask for assistance via the Passenger Help Point to access taxis to nearby amenities.
